How a card illustration is created



 

 

Step ONE:
After discussing the concept with the client, I sharpen the ol' #2 pencil and get to work.

 

 

 

 

 

 

Step TWO:
I then scan and e-mail the sketch for approval. If there are any editing requests I modify the sketch and re-send it... Once the sketch is approved, it's time to break out the pen and ink!


 


 


 

Step THREE:
After the line art has been completed, it is then reproduced onto 80lb.card stock and hand-watercolored. The final color art is either scanned and e-mailed, or the original is sent to the client for direct scanning.

 

 

 

*NOTE: The color stage is NOT subject to editing as it is done by hand and not on computer. Also, the originals that are mailed to the client are just that, ORIGINALS. They are NOT on disk!
